There's a section(I don't know the official name) that consists of an uphill right-left-right ess turn that encompasses a parking lot-esque area to its left(complete with speed bumps). Normally this section is reversed for drifting and turned into almost an exact replica of the Road Atlanta FD course. If that section is followed to the side road on the right instead of following the track on the left, it has a nice little kink to "jump" off of(flying hachiroku anyone) and a long wall to slide against until you get back to the track on the left..I think I have a replay saved of it(no I didn't buy dlc) so ill see if I can upload pics later

It is wide only in the "after wall ride section" because that entire chain of corners is 1 section in the editor but the wall section if the correct line is taken, provides just the right backwards entry into the following corners which i agree should be tighter. Tandeming these corners proves to be quite a feat when done properly as my last few drifts with random drifters proved that not just anyone could attack that section. I hope the section can be taken advantage of in comps if the line is done correctly, it would prove to be an intense tandem challenge im sure. The wall ride is a 4th gear entry down to a nearly 2nd gear exit back to a 3rd gear transition section... in my 240 of about 380hp which is around the power of the cars most often seen in the meihan videos ( living in japan with people from the area that know some of the burst members personally). Its a great section full of hours of fun playability if learned properly.
